Living an Examined Life
Author(s): James Hollis, Ph.D.

How do you define "growing up?" Does it mean you achieve certain cultural benchmarks—a steady income, paying taxes, marriage and children? Or does it mean leaving behind the expectations of others and growing into the person you were meant to be? With the unabridged audio of Living an Examined Life, James Hollis offers an essential guidebook for anyone at a crossroads in life. Here this acclaimed author guides you through 21 areas for self-inquiry and growth—such as how to exorcise the ghosts of your past, when to choose meaning over happiness, how to construct a mature spirituality, and how to seize permission to be who you really are.
